Wgt: 12.5 lbs
Recoil: much better than a boltgun.
Brake: not unless you want your ears blowed off!
Fit/Finish: Excellent
Barrerl: 20" heavy fluted

These models are off the .308 upper's and have no dust covers or forward assist.

I have the .308 models and they shoot very well too. Would hold off on this one for a while as mags are the problem for the moment. 10rd .308 mag only holds 3 rds and factory ammo oal is slightly too long. My rifle is a prototype for testing.
